Transaction 51ddf2636ae6d17ccd5b9ab46b10b9710e161547c7bcf8b7d540efb569f756a3
1 Input
1 Output
-
51ddf2636ae6d17ccd5b9ab46b10b9710e161547c7bcf8b7d540efb569f756a3:0
- value
- 5709314
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5378991d5dff075960a2824193eb18685386f0f9 OP_EQUAL
- address
- 39JNUmYj7qaAAiGXw8czUW6EgPsBCqGJVD